Castleman's disease is a rare event that gastroenterologists should be familiar with. We present a case of Castleman's disease presenting as acute pancreatitis. The diagnosis was established by excisional biopsy of a superficial lymph node and the patient had a favorable prognosis with chemotherapy. This case is reminiscent of acute pancreatitis with multiple lymphadenopathy and should raise suspicion for Castleman's disease.
